You can create a mail merge file in two ways. You can base the mail merge file on an existing mailing list, or you can base it on prospects and contacts.

Create a mail merge file based on an existing mailing list

When you create a mail merge file based on an existing mailing list, all records that have a status of Not sent in the Mailings form are sent to the mail merge file. Therefore, you cannot use the Mailings form for long-term storage of mailing lists that have a status of Not sent.

  1. Click Sales and marketing > Periodic > Mailings > Mailings.

  2. Click Create mailing file.

  3. Enter the full location of the mail merge file as the file name.

  4. Select the Update status check box to update the status, date, and history of the mailing. The status is changed from Not sent to Sent.

  5. Select the date on which you want to send the mailing.

Note

Only mailing lists that have a status of Not sent are updated to a status of Sent when the check box is selected.

Create a mail merge file based on prospects and contacts

You can create a mail merge file by filtering the Prospects and Contacts tables.

  1. Click Sales and marketing > Periodic > Mailings > Create mailing file.

  2. Specify the full location of the mail merge file.

  3. Select the Update status check box to update the status of the mailing list in the Prospects form.

  4. Select the date on which you want to send the mailing.

    If you select the Update status check box, the Date sent value is registered in both the Prospects and the Contacts forms.

  5. Click Select. Then, in the Mailing file query form, change, add, or remove filter fields as necessary.

  6. Click OK to accept the query and the values in the filter fields.

  7. Click OK to generate the mail merge file in the location that you specified.
